Satellite quality

The number of green bars indicates the satellite signal quality.

Following table describes the meaning in more detail:

Number of green bars Meaning
0 No satellites available
1 Satellite quality is based on the last known fix
2 Satellite quality is poor (Only a 2-D fix is available, likely due to a limited number of tracked satellites)
3 Satellite quality is usable (A 3-D fix is available, with marginal HDOP (horizontal dilution of precision))
4 Satellite quality is good (A 3-D fix is available, with good-to-excellent HDOP)

ANT+ sensors

The Cycling App Professional supports following ANT+ sensors:

  • ANT+ speed sensor
  • ANT+ cadence sensor
  • ANT+ heart rate sensor
  • ANT+ temperature sensor
  • ANT+ power sensor
  • for all devices where Garmin supports the power profile natively
  • for all other devices we implemented our own ANT+ power profile support

Note:
Except for the own power profile implementation, please pair the ANT+ sensor(s) before starting the application in your watch settings!

Note:
Some sensors support ANT+ and BLE. Please make sure you paired the sensors for ANT+!
